Transaction 5390815abcb7dee14d327ef672e5d38fe6dcb5396cd0f588061ce39f447bd66f
1 Input
1 Output
-
5390815abcb7dee14d327ef672e5d38fe6dcb5396cd0f588061ce39f447bd66f:0
- value
- 1084565272272
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ce0f7bedf38791249c63ccffa25cfd15195a110 OP_EQUALVERIFY OP_CHECKSIG
- address
- DDcCCwWLMH9vJpsXcy5h5wR1EDrQt91BCa